Shanghai subway crash revives safety concerns (AP)

SHANGHAI ? A crash on one of Shanghai's newest subway lines, the latest stumble in China's rush to roll out modern services, is focusing attention on the use of high-tech signal systems that at times are anything but fail-safe.

The collision Tuesday, which the government says injured 284 people, revived complaints that China is sacrificing safety in its zeal for fast results.

The subway operator, Shanghai Shentong Metro Group, said one of its trains crashed into another near the city's scenic Yuyuan Garden due to problems with signal systems supplied by a state-owned venture whose equipment was implicated in a deadly bullet train crash in July.

It was not the first problem on the line. A mishap involving the misdirecting of a train two months earlier had resulted in assurances of no more accidents from the maker of the signal system, Casco Signal Ltd.

"We certainly intend to get to the bottom of this," the metro's chairman Yu Guangyao told reporters.

Casco, a joint venture of China Railway Signal and Communication Corp., or CRSC, and France's Alstom, SA, was set up in the mid-1980s and is a major supplier of signal systems and other electronic equipment for China's railways and subway systems.

It also supplied a centralized traffic control system for the railway in east China's Zhejiang province where two bullet trains crashed on July 23, killing 40 people and injuring 177.

While the two systems are not the same, the problems with signaling and communications on the subway's "Line 10" raised eyebrows: At the time of the crash, the crowded trains were operating at lower than usual speeds and being directed via phone by subway staff rather than by electronic signals.

High-tech automatic train protection systems, installed to improve safety while allowing more trains to travel within shorter intervals, normally would signal the presence of the train, preventing another from approaching. But such systems sometimes fail due to circuit problems, as with a June 2009 Metro train derailment in Washington, D.C. that killed nine people.

Like the bullet train crash, which experts say resulted both from equipment and human error, Shanghai's problems likely are not limited to the signaling equipment.

"There is no doubt that the signaling equipment is the most direct and obvious cause," said Li Hongchang, a professor of economics and management at Beijing Jiaotong University. "The deeper cause lies in maintenance, management and even in whether contracts were awarded in a fair and open way in the first place."

Staff at Casco's headquarters refused comment Wednesday.

CRSC had declared August a "signaling quality" month, deploying engineers to inspect projects and reduce risks, it said in an announcement on its website.

Alstom has 10,000 employees in China, where it has been supplying trains and equipment to China for over 50 years. Its Urbalis signaling system, the one being used on Line 10, is used on at least seven subway lines in China, including several in Beijing, three in Shanghai and one in Shenzhen, according to a company press release.

China's multi-trillion dollar building boom is knitting the country together as never before, with high-speed trains, smooth new super highways, cruise terminals and brand new airports.

But many of the projects, built at hyper speed to meet deadlines that often appear geared more to political grandstanding than safety, have fallen prey to quality and safety problems.

"Given the serious traffic jam problems in big cities like Beijing and Shanghai, generally it is better to have more subways and have them earlier," said Li, the professor.

"But the rush is too hot in some places, too many subways built too quickly," Li said. Construction often starts before projects are fully designed to save time, he said.

The momentum to build quickly and massively is built into a system dominated by state-owned companies whose party-appointed top executives often enjoy insider influence with the officials awarding contracts.

CRSC, for example, is among the many big state companies that have thrived on China's massive railways buildup, further fortified by huge cash pools from share listings. Most of the company's overseas projects, according to its website, have been in the developing world ? North Korea, Pakistan, Iran and Tanzania ? or at home.

The subway crash was a shock for Shanghai, a city of 23 million that prides itself on its fancy new infrastructure ? roads, airports, ports, tunnels and subways all expanded dramatically ahead of the city's 2010 World Expo.

But as with elsewhere in China, the cracks in the veneer already were showing, just like the recent reports of shattering glass and crumbling concrete at the city's new Hongqiao International Airport terminal.

Tuesday's was the third system failure in two months on the subway's "Line 10", which reportedly was set to switch to completely automated operations next month, eliminating the need for train attendants to drive or operate the doors of the trains.

Such high-tech features are worlds away from the long bicycle and bus commutes of the past. But they are not always worth it, said Zhang Xide, an economics professor at the Chinese Academy of Governance.

"Infrastructure investment is irreversible," Zhang said. "If something goes wrong, the cost is high."

Calls rise for global focus on creating jobs (AP)

PARIS ? World governments must not let their focus on spending cuts keep them from creating jobs that will be a key part of economic recovery, an international group of experts warned on Monday.

The Organization for Economic Cooperation and Development and the International Labor Organization say government support for the unemployed ? both with subsidies and job training ? is vital since long-term joblessness is particularly intractable.

The employment ministers of the Group of 20 leading economies were meeting Monday and Tuesday in Paris to discuss the situation. But the agencies' call to spend more money ? even on job creation ? could have difficulty gaining traction in the current climate of budget cuts.

Many countries, especially in Europe, are being forced to slash their budgets to win back the confidence of investors, who are concerned that deficits and debts are out of control. Greece, for example, is teetering on the brink of default because it can't afford to pay its bills while also paying down its debts.

Public sector payrolls have been slashed savagely and economic uncertainty is keeping businesses from hiring.

Maurizio Sacconi, Italy's labor minister, said at Monday's meeting that governments have to "stimulate growth with employment because we are aware of the danger of a jobless recovery, of jobless growth."

The bind the most indebted countries like Greece find themselves in is that they have little or no money to spend. They need to cut costs or raise taxes or both to pay down debts, but will never pay them down sufficiently if growth doesn't increase.

But as the global economic slowdown intensifies, unemployment has risen on governments' lists of concerns.

Currently, 200 million people are out of work worldwide ? a figure that approaches the worst depths of the recession ? according to the ILO and the OECD, the Paris-based watchdog for the world's most developed economies.

The two groups say slow growth since the 2008 crisis has resulted in a shortfall of 20 million jobs in the G-20 countries. If average employment growth slips just two-tenths of a percentage point more ? to 0.8 percent ? that figure could grow to 40 million by 2015.

By contrast, those economies taken together would need an average of 1.3 percent employment growth over the next three years to absorb that 20 million.

"This is the human face of the crisis," the heads of the two organizations said in a letter to the G-20 employment ministers on Monday. "Governments cannot ignore it."

The ministers are expected to release a statement laying out their commitments at the end of their meeting on Tuesday.

The economic figures ? and the sometimes violent protests by people resisting cuts ? are beginning to change government priorities. Politicians in several countries, including Greece and Spain ? with 16 and 21 percent unemployment, respectively ? are agitating for an increased focus on job-creation.

French President Nicolas Sarkozy emphasized in a speech later Monday that employment "must be at the heart of our priorities."

However, he added, fundamental rights must be respected in G20 countries.

"Protection for the weakest must be an imperative," the French president said, adding that G20 nations who also are members of the International Labor Organization should ratify the eight ILO conventions on fundamental rights that notably forbid child labor and call for gender equality.

Sarkozy said he would like to see the ILO gain observer status at the World Trade Organization.

How to create jobs is a topic of much debate. Some say governments should steer clear of spending money to boost employment but only create a good climate for businesses.

"That means reduce the regulatory pressure, the fiscal pressure that weighs on companies in terms of hiring," said Marc Touati, the chief economist at investment company Assya. It's not a just a matter of cutting spending, he said, but also rethinking spending.

The OECD and ILO insist that while austerity may be necessary, governments have a role in creating jobs.

"For those countries where there is some fiscal space, our message will be, use it," Stefano Scarpetta, the leading employment expert at the OECD, told reporters on Monday. "For those countries where the fiscal space is very limited, try to create this fiscal space."

He conceded that countries do need to reduce their budgets, but said money must be found to give businesses the confidence to hire. He praised in particular to the Obama administration's plan to cut payroll taxes for employers who take on new workers.

Without those incentives, he said that even companies in good financial standing would stay on the sidelines, waiting to see if the economy is starting to grow before hiring.

The danger is that a vicious cycle might ensue. The economy won't grow in a meaningful way until hiring picks up, but hiring is unlikely to pick up until employers feel the economy is going to start growing.

Scarpetta says the G-20 has to find a way to give businesses that confidence.

"Our concerns about the labor market situation have, if anything, become even more serious" in recent weeks, said Scarpetta.

Lowe pounded again, Braves routed by Phillies 7-1 (AP)

ATLANTA ? Dan Uggla drop-kicked his bat after striking out on three pitches. Chipper Jones slammed his bat into the dirt after popping up. Derek Lowe just trudged off the mound to another round of boos from the home crowd, wondering how it all went wrong.

The Braves are mad and frustrated heading to the 162nd game.

Their season is on the brink after a potentially historic collapse.

"It's like living out a bad dream," Jones said.

Lowe had another miserable outing, surrendering five runs in four-plus innings, and the Braves took another step toward giving away a playoff berth that seemed certain just a few weeks ago with an ugly 7-1 loss to the Philadelphia Phillies on Tuesday night.

St. Louis pulled even with the Braves, rallying from an early 5-0 deficit to beat the Houston Astros 13-6. Atlanta took sole possession of the NL wild-card lead on June 20 and had held it until Tuesday, according to STATS LLC.

Chase Utley, Hunter Pence and Jimmy Rollins homered to back a three-hit outing by Roy Oswalt (9-10), who tuned up for the playoffs with a strong performance in a largely disappointing season.

Talk about disappointing. Look what's happened to the Braves.

They lost their fourth in a row and eighth in 11 games, sending them to the final day of the regular season tied with the Cardinals. Atlanta had an 8 1/2-game lead just three weeks ago.

"We've got one game to play in the month of September, then October comes around and it's a new month," Braves manager Fredi Gonzalez said. "There's not a person in that locker room who I wouldn't want to be on my team to play that game."

"I would hope so," Jones said, trying to make light of the grim situation. "We're pretty much all he has anyway."

Sixteen-game winner Tim Hudson will try to wrap up the wild card or at least force a one-game playoff against Cardinals, which would be Thursday night in St. Louis.

"It is what it is," Gonzalez said. "We've played 161 games and it comes down to one. We've done it to ourselves. No excuses there. We've got to go get it tomorrow."

Lowe (9-17) has been a $15 million bust for the Braves, losing all five of his September starts and drawing the ire of Atlanta fans. They cheered lustily when Gonzalez popped out of the dugout to make a pitching change after Lowe gave up a leadoff single in the fifth, then heckled the high-priced right-hander as he trudged to the dugout ? and straight to the showers without so much as a pause.

"When you're 9-17 with a (5.05) ERA, come on, there's really nothing you can say to sugarcoat it," Lowe said. "I'm man enough to say I've had a terrible year. But we've still got a chance. Our best pitcher is going tomorrow. This isn't about me. This is about this organization and how much hard work these guys have put in this season."

The NL East champion Phillies, winning their 101st game of the season, jumped ahead on the eighth pitch of the game. Lowe served up one to Utley, who drove it into center-field seats for his 11th homer.

An uneasy feeling settled over Turner Field. It would only get worse.

The Phillies extended the lead to 3-0 in the third on Rollins' run-scoring and Pence's sacrifice fly, the inning helped along by Lowe's ill-advised decision to try to get the lead runner at third on Oswalt's sacrifice. Carlos Ruiz beat the throw and everyone was safe.

The advantage grew to 4-0 in the fourth when two singles set up another sacrifice fly, this one by Placido Polanco.

Philadelphia finished off Lowe in the fifth. When Rollins led off with a single, rookie Arodys Vizcaino was summoned from the bullpen. But the youngster gave up a towering two-run homer to Pence, his 22nd, that turned the game into a full-fledged rout.

Rollins added his 16th homer in the seventh off another Braves rookie, Julio Teheran.

The Braves fans stopped booing long enough to cheer on the last-place Astros from afar, breaking into periodic chants of "Let's Go Houston!"

"I heard it," said Braves center fielder Michael Bourn, who was acquired from the Astros at the trade deadline. "I was actually bobbing my head to it. I'm right there with 'em. Let's go Astros. You can't be against that."

The top three hitters in the Phillies' lineup ? Rollins, Utley and Pence ? combined to go 6 for 12 with three homers, five RBIs and four runs scored. Rollins had three hits and Pence drove in three runs.

Manager Charlie Manuel improved his record in Philadelphia to 645-488, tying Gene Mauch (645-684) for the most wins in franchise history.

"I'll get more out of it when I beat him," Manuel joked. "That's a good sign of the teams we've had."

No one in the Atlanta lineup did anything until Martin Prado hit a meaningless homer off Kyle Kendrick in the ninth to keep the Braves from their second shutout in four games. They've scored only four runs in that span.

Staked to a comfortable lead, Oswalt went on cruise control. The right-hander went six innings and allowed just two runners to get as far as second base. His only real trouble came in the third when Bourn singled, stole second and Prado reached as Rollins bobbled a grounder at shortstop for an error. But Jones, who had an MRI on his ailing right knee before the game, grounded into a double play.

"My arm's strength back," Oswalt said. "My breaking pitch was working pretty well. Hopefully, it'll carry into the playoffs."

Jones and the Braves just want to make it to the playoffs. "You never expect this to happen to you," he said.

NOTES: The Phillies won their third in a row and improved to 11-6 against the Braves in the season series. ... RHP Jair Jurrjens is scheduled to pitch Thursday in the Florida instructional league in what the Braves are hoping will be a tuneup for the playoffs. He's been out with a bone bruise in his right knee. ... The Braves had hoped to save Hudson (16-10) for the playoffs, but their No. 1 starter has to go Wednesday with the season on the line. Joe Blanton (1-2) gets the nod for the Phillies, who also plan to use starter Cole Hamels for a couple of innings in relief, as well as a series of relievers. ... Braves SS Alex Gonzalez left the game in the second inning after re-injuring his strained right calf. Fredi Gonzalez said the injury appears more serious than before and he doesn't expect his starter to play on Wednesday. Jack Wilson would fill in.

How graphene's electrical properties can be tuned

Monday, September 26, 2011

An accidental discovery in a physicist's laboratory at the University of California, Riverside provides a unique route for tuning the electrical properties of graphene, nature's thinnest elastic material. This route holds great promise for replacing silicon with graphene in the microchip industry.

The researchers found that stacking up three layers of graphene, like pancakes, significantly modifies the material's electrical properties. When they fabricated trilayer graphene in the lab and measured its conductance, they found, to their surprise, that depending on how the layers were stacked some of the trilayer graphene devices were conducting while others were insulating.

"What we stumbled upon is a simple and convenient 'knob' for tuning graphene sheets' electrical properties," said Jeanie Lau, an associate professor of physics and astronomy, whose lab made the serendipitous finding.

Study results appeared online Sept. 25 in Nature Physics.

Graphene is a one-atom thick sheet of carbon atoms arranged in hexagonal rings. Bearing excellent material properties, such as high current-carrying capacity and thermal conductivity, this "wonder material" is ideally suited for creating components for semiconductor circuits and computers.

Because of the planar and chicken wire-like structure of graphene, its sheets lend themselves well to stacking in what is called 'Bernal stacking,' the stacking fashion of graphene sheets.

In a Bernal-stacked bilayer, one corner of the hexagons of the second sheet is located above the center of the hexagons of the bottom sheet. In Bernal-stacked trilayer (ABA), the top (third) sheet is exactly on top of the lowest sheet. In rhombohedral-stacked (ABC) trilayer, the top sheet is shifted by the distance of an atom, so that the top (third) sheet and the lowest sheet form a Bernal stacking as well.

"The most stable form of trilayer graphene is ABA, which behaves like a metal," Lau explained. "Amazingly, if we simply shift the entire topmost layer by the distance of a single atom, the trilayer ? now with ABC or rhombohedral stacking ? becomes insulating. Why this happens is not clear as yet. It could be induced by electronic interactions. We eagerly await an explanation from theorists!"

Her lab used Raman spectroscopy to examine the graphene devices' stacking orders. Next the lab plans to investigate the nature of the insulating state in ABC-stacked graphene. In this kind of stacked graphene, they also plan to study the band gap ? a range in energy, critical for digital applications, in which no electrons can exist.

"The presence of the gap in ABC-stacked graphene that arises, we believe, from enhanced electronic interactions is interesting since it is not expected from theoretical calculations," Lau said. "Understanding this gap is particularly important for the major challenge of band gap engineering in graphene electronics."

Tips to Remember When Looking for Outdoor Camping Tents

When it comes to enjoying the great outdoors, you will find that there is one piece of camping gear that will be more important than the rest: your tent. Outdoor camping tents are the most important piece of equipment that you will need to go camping. Think about it: you can cook over an open fire, you can scrounge for food, and you can even use leaves as toilet paper, but it's not the same if you are sleeping out under the open stars or a heavy rain.

Choosing your tent will make or break your camping trip, and it is important that you choose the best quality camping tents when planning your outdoor adventure. If you choose the right tent, you will be able to sleep in peace, comfort, and total luxury. If you choose the wrong tent, you may find that it will blow away, be difficult to erect, be too cramped for all of you, or even leak. The best quality camping tents should be the only ones you buy, as only the quality outdoor camping tents will put up with the wear and tear of camping life.

Here are some things to remember when looking for outdoor camping tents:

  • The size of your tent is one of the most important factors to consider. If you are one person camping alone, you will require a much smaller tent than 4 people sleeping together. If your tent is too big, that will not be much of a problem. A tent that is too small, however, will be uncomfortable and cramped. Choose a tent that will accommodate all of the camping party comfortably, and you may find that getting a bigger tent than you need can actually make the trip more comfortable.
  • The material used for the tent is another important factor to take into account. Obviously the tent will be made from a synthetic material, but you should also consider the quality of the material that you will purchase. The stronger the nylon used for the tent, the more likely it will be to put up with the abuse of a number of people going in and out of a tent on a camping trip.
  • If you are driving to your destination, you will find that any camping tent will suffice. However, hiking to your camping place will mean that your tent will need to be lightweight, as carrying around a heavy tent is exhausting. Consider whether you will be hiking, backpacking, walking, or simply driving to your camping spot, as that can help you purchase a tent that will be the right weight.

These three things are the most important things to consider, and you will find that there are many brands of outdoor camping tents that will meet your expectations and be excellent quality. As long as you consider these things, you will find that your outdoor camping tents will be comfortable when you are on a long camping trip.?

Global crisis: Is China's economy in trouble too? | Zaykar Global ...

HONG KONG ? Is China?s economy in trouble, too? As the U.S. economy appears to teeter on the edge of another recession, Europe struggles with a financial crisis and emerging markets like Brazil and India show new weaknesses, China might appear to be in better shape than most countries, economists say. But ?better? is relative.

On the surface, economists at the International Monetary Fund and most banks are still estimating China?s growth rate to be more than 9 percent this year. China continues to run very large trade surpluses. New construction starts have soared with a government campaign to provide more affordable housing.

And yet, the country?s huge manufacturing sector is starting to slow and orders are weakening, especially for exports. The real estate bubble is starting to spring leaks, even as inflation remains stubbornly high for consumers ? despite a series of interest rate increases and ever-tighter limits on bank lending.

Because China?s mighty growth engine has been one of the few drivers of the global economy since the financial crisis of 2008, signs of deceleration could add to worries about the global outlook.

A survey of Chinese purchasing managers, just completed by HSBC and Markit Economics, shows a third consecutive month of contraction in the manufacturing sector. The release of the survey results Thursday contributed to a global slide in stock markets that day.

Meanwhile, huge loans that Chinese banks have made to state-owned enterprises and local governments over the past three years could cause trouble if the economy does slow.

What?s more, there are further signs of trade hostilities from Washington, where the impulse is to blame China?s cheap exports, at least partly, for the U.S.? continued high unemployment. On Thursday, a bipartisan group of senators announced that they would pursue legislation requiring the Obama administration to confront China more directly on currency policy. They want the White House to push harder for China to allow its currency, the renminbi, to appreciate.

If China does allow its currency to rise more quickly and if its trade surplus narrows, that could help economies elsewhere. But too much of a slowdown in China could simply add to the world?s financial gloom.

Chinese exporters are particularly worried. Nicole Huang, the sales manager at Dongguan Lianyi Sport Goods Co. Ltd., a maker of beer coolers, diving suits and other products in the industrial hub city of Dongguan, said the number of orders had dropped 5 percent so far this year, and the average size of each order had also begun to shrink.

And instead of the labor shortages that plagued many manufacturers last year as workers sought better jobs elsewhere, more people now seem willing to accept assembly-line tedium. Short term, that could help exporters. But it could be an early sign of looming unemployment problems.

Heavier kids experience more social problems (Reuters)

NEW YORK (Reuters Health) ? Children who are heavier than their peers at ages four and five are more likely to struggle in their relationships with other kids several years later, an Australian study suggests.

After following more than 3,300 children for about four years, researchers found that the heavy kids were up to 20 percent more likely at age eight or nine to be described by their parents as having social difficulties and by teachers as having emotional problems.

"It's interesting that we're seeing these problems at an early age," said Christina Calamaro, a professor at the University of Maryland School of Nursing, who did not participate in the research.

"I think this speaks to the fact that health care providers need to take weight into consideration at an earlier age, so we can cut it off at the pass before they hit middle school," she told Reuters Health.

The researchers surveyed the parents and teachers of 3,363 Australian children participating in a large national health study. The interviews were conducted first when the kids were four or five, and again four years later.

The questions involved measures of children's mental and behavioral health, such as emotional problems, hyperactivity and social skills.

Children also had their weight and height checked at each age.

At ages four and five, 222 boys (13 percent) and 264 girls (16 percent) were determined to be overweight, while 77 boys (4.5 percent) and 87 girls (5.2 percent) were obese.

Those kids with a body mass index (BMI -- a measure of weight relative to height) at least 1.6 points greater than their normal-weight peers at a young age were more at risk of having social problems, including isolation or teasing, later on.

For a five year old boy who is 40 inches tall and 40 pounds, for instance, a 1.6-point increase in BMI would translate into a weight gain of about two pounds.

At ages eight and nine, the heavier kids were 15 percent more likely to receive an evaluation of "concerning," based on parents' and teachers' responses about social interactions with peers. The heavy kids were also 20 percent more likely to get a "concerning" score from teachers on emotional development.

Lead author Michael Sawyer, a professor at the University of Adelaide, said it's important to evaluate children's social life in grade school because this is the age at which it starts to increase in importance.

"The quality of peer relationships during this period of time has the potential to have a significant impact on children's later mental health," Sawyer wrote in an email to Reuters Health.

In the study, published in the journal Pediatrics, the authors write that the stigma of being overweight can translate into social struggles for these children, and the kids might withdraw themselves from social activities because they fear teasing.

Obese children are more likely to be bullied (see Reuters Health story of May 3, 2010).

Sawyer's group did not find any differences between the heavy kids and the normal weight kids in their risk of mental health problems, such as hyperactivity or conduct disorders.

Other studies have found that later in life, however, obesity puts adults at greater risk of developing a mental illness like depression or anxiety.

Sawyer said he'd like to continue following the children to see whether the social problems his study revealed might be precursors to later mental health problems.
